Catholic groups file suit over HHS birth control mandate

Dozens of Catholic universities, dioceses and other institutions filed lawsuits in courts around the country on Monday (May 21) in a coordinated effort, spearheaded by the U.S. hierarchy and Catholic conservatives, to overturn the Obama administration’s contraception mandate plan.

Millwood Farmers Market open for business

Eating locally grown, healthy, sustainable foods is something close to the Rev. Craig Goodwin's heart.

He serves as pastor of Millwood Community Presbyterian Church and is the director of the Millwood Farmer's Market, which is beginning its sixth season.
